GLA高产菌株的筛选及菌丝体脂肪酸组成的气相色谱质谱分析

【摘要】 筛选出1株菌丝体脂肪酸中GLA含量在18%以上的高产菌株,经鉴定为刺孢小克银汉霉(Cunninghamellaechinulata).采用气相色谱质谱对菌丝体脂肪酸组成进行分析,共检测出12种脂肪酸,其中不饱和脂肪酸含量为81.3%,主要为油酸(OA)、亚油酸(LA)、γ亚麻酸(GLA),还含有少量的二十碳五烯酸(EPA)和二十二碳六烯酸(DHA)等,初步表明筛选获得了1株高产GLA的发酵生产菌株.

【Abstract】 <Abstrcat>A fungus was obtained and identified to be Cunninghamella echinulata from the soil sample of different areas, it produced relatively large amount of oil with GLA(>18.0%). The components of it’s mycelium fatty acids were analyzed by GC-SM. Twelve fatty acids were identified and their relative contents were determined. Polyunsaturated fatty acids in the mycelium oil accounted for 81.3% and mainly comprised Oleic acid (OA) Linoleic acid(LA) r-Linolenic acid (GLA), contained a little Eicosapentaenoic (EPA) and Docosahexaenoic (DHA). The results indicated that it is a GLA productive fungus.
